1999 Honda Prelude vs. 1996 Vauxhall Astra
To start off, 1999 Honda Prelude is newer by 3 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1996 Vauxhall Astra.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1996 Vauxhall Astra would be higher. At 1,997 cc (4 cylinders), 1999 Honda Prelude is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1999 Honda Prelude (132 HP) has 58 more horse power than 1996 Vauxhall Astra. (74 HP). In normal driving conditions, 1999 Honda Prelude should accelerate faster than 1996 Vauxhall Astra.
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1999 Honda Prelude (178 Nm) has 51 more torque (in Nm) than 1996 Vauxhall Astra. (127 Nm). This means 1999 Honda Prelude will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1996 Vauxhall Astra.
